    Doolittle Raiders Memorial Toast

    AFA’s Doolittle Leadership Center is thrilled to present the Doolittle Raiders Memorial Toast, a U.S. Air Force Heritage event taking place April 18, 2024. Reigniting a decades-long Air Force tradition started by AFA’s founding president Gen. Jimmy Doolittle and his fellow Raiders in 1945, AFA members around the world will raise a glass to the 82nd anniversary of the legendary Doolittle Raid and the Raiders’ enduring warfighting spirit, bravery, and innovation.

    The keynote speaker and toastmaster will be Gen. Thomas A. Bussiere, Commander of Air Force Global Strike Command.

    FAQ

    How can I participate in the Doolittle Raiders Toast?

    AFA will be livestreaming the event on YouTube so that you or your organization can toast along with us from anywhere in the world. The livestream will begin at 5:45 p.m. ET and last for 40-45 minutes.

    What does the ceremony entail?

    The ceremony will begin at 5:45 p.m. ET with an invocation, brief historical background on the Doolittle Raid, and remarks by Gen. Bussiere. A presentation remembering all 80 Doolittle Raiders will culminate in the traditional Toast at 6:18 p.m. ET.

    The ceremony livestream time doesn’t work for me. Can I still access the Toast?

    The Doolittle Leadership Center will post the recorded livestream on our YouTube channel as soon as the event is over. Feel free to use the recording in your own ceremony or on its own.

    Are there instructions for how I or my group can prepare for participating?

    Yes! Please download this PDF explaining the traditional requirements and wording for the Doolittle Raiders Toast. We recommend using Hennessey Cognac, Jimmy’s favorite, for the Toast itself.

    My organization already has plans for the commemorating the Toast. Can I still be involved?

    Yes! We encourage using our livestream or recording in your own ceremony. We will provide the basics—historical background, an invocation, a listing of the Raiders according to bomber crew, and the traditionally worded Toast presentation—but we encourage more detailed, unique traditions to live on in your organization or unit.
